Faux Finishing is not new. In fact history and archeological evidence shows that the ancient Greeks and Egyptians applied decorative finishes to the walls of their homes. In the heyday of ancient Rome, well to do homeowners had faux artists paint their villas. Today many schools, in this country and around the world, teach the art of Faux Finishing. Adding a bit of texture to a hallway, or a sense of drama in the dining room can enhance and enliven ordinary walls. To the novice or the do-it yourselfer, Faux Finishing can be a daunting challenge.
